Man of the East (E poi lo chiamarono il magnifico, 1972) is a comedy western starring Terence Hill, ready to watch online on iFILM. A prim young Englishman named Joe travels to the Wild West to honor his dying father's wish: become a real man out here. The catch is that Joe hates guns and would rather ride a bicycle than a horse.
Three good-natured outlaws take charge of his education, more out of laziness than kindness, and their pupil is hopeless. His fancy manners turn him into the joke of the town. Things get harder when he falls for rancher Ohlsen's daughter — because Morton, a hulking brute, has already claimed her hand. Sooner or later Joe will have to either throw a punch or pack his bags.
Behind the camera is Enzo Barboni, the same director who made the Trinity films, and his fingerprints are everywhere: slapstick brawls, a slow-moving hero and plenty of fists with no blood in sight. Hill is charming in a new register here, playing a klutz rather than a gunslinger as he learns to fit in. Easygoing fun for anyone who likes Italian westerns light on pomp and lethal gunfire.
